Starting December 3rd, new users will be able to get Xbox Game Pass for $1, only available for the first three months. Xbox Community Manager, Megan Spurt, said the deal is for those that haven’t tried the Xbox game Pass yet - “for those that haven’t tried Xbox Game Pass Ultimate yet, for a limited time starting December 3 you can get your first three months for $1!.” Get three months of Xbox Game Pass Ultimate for $1. This deal is part of the Xbox holiday offer. The inclusion of EA Play into Game Pass Ultimate is a really smart move that continues to highlight Microsoft's big strength over their competition this holiday. From Tropico to Worms to Bloodstained, Game Pass subscribers with a capable PC are about to have a whole lot more options at their disposal when they pick their next game. The service also hosts a good collection of third-party titles, including pretty much every Star Wars game ever released on PC. The PC version of the subscription service stretches back even farther into EA's history, letting players delve into the history of franchises like Medal of Honor, Command & Conquer, and Sim City. EA Play also extends out to PC via their Origin client, and that will reach to Game Pass subscribers as well.
